Dr. Jennifer Schaumberg’s journey to becoming an Oral and Maxillofacial Surgeon began at the University of Michigan, where she completed both her undergraduate education and earned her Doctor of Dental Surgery degree. Driven by a passion for surgery and patient care, she continued her training through an internship and residency in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ery at the University of Miami/Jackson Memorial Hospital. Those years provided a rigorous foundation in complex surgical care while reinforcing the importance of compassion, precision, and lifelong learning.

After completing her training, she entered private practice with the goal of building more than a surgical office—she wanted to create a place where patients felt genuinely cared for and supported.As her practice grew, so did her family. Becoming the mother of three children strengthened her empathy, resilience, and commitment to treating every patient with respect, honesty, and individualized care. Surviving Stage III breast cancer gave Dr. Schaumberg a deeper understanding of the patient experience, strengthening her commitment to compassionate care, meaningful relationships, and serving her community.
